About Mike Lehner
(Top Expert on this page)

Expertise
All areas of residential heating and cooling service/repair. I am a service technician and have been all of my career. I can't stand to see people ripped off or sold new units when it needed simple repairs. I have specialized in geothermal, hydronics and fuel oil. I can answer questions on accessories such as humidifiers and ventilators. Will answer questions on ductless split system, commercial ice machines and commercial refrigeration, zoning, heat pumps, tankless hot water , and thermostats. Experiance in both old units and all the new residential equipment such as modulating furnaces and two stage a/c units.

Experience
15 years experience in residential service and commercial refrigeration

Organizations
Refrigeration Service Engineers Society North American Technician Excellance

Education/Credentials
Two year technical school degree, North American Technician Excellance certified in residential: fuel oil, a/c and heat pumps, American Refrigeration Institute certified in residential: a/c, air distribution, heat pumps, gas furnace and oil furnace, Ongoing yearly fuel oil training through Beckett national education program and national oilheat research alliance, Yearly Fujitsu ductless split and Rinnai tankless water heater training

Awards and Honors
Manitowoc field service ice machine factory trained
